Overview: Introducting Tratto

Tratto offers a mixed experience, where its culinary efforts often shine, particularly with its well-regarded pizza and pasta dishes. However, some guests have noted inconsistencies, with certain meals described as bland or undercooked .

The inviting ambience generally receives praise, creating a pleasant backdrop for dining. While the staff can be quite attentive and friendly, there are instances where service falls short, leading to frustration.

The overall value proposition also raises questions for some, who find the pricing structure less than ideal, especially concerning additional gratuity .

Verdict: Our expert take on Tratto

Food (7.2 out of 10)

mentioned by 91% of the guests

When it comes to the food, this spot generally hits the mark! With a good score of 7.2 and customer satisfaction sitting at a respectable 71.5%, it's clear many diners leave happy. Out of 302 total remarks, 216 were positive, frequently highlighting the fresh made pasta, delicious sauces, wonderful pizzas, and crispy fried chicken thighs.

However, not every dish is a home run. Among the 66 negative opinions, some guests noted issues like small portions, greasy pizza, mediocre quality, and a general lack of flavor in certain dishes. It seems consistency can be a bit of a mixed bag, so choose wisely.

Service (5.5 out of 10)

mentioned by 78% of the guests

When it comes to service, many guests have found reasons to smile, with 78 positive remarks highlighting a fantastic team and attentive staff. Guests frequently mention quick service and individual standouts like Kevin the bartender, contributing to many positive interactions. However, the experience isn't always consistent, with an equal 78 negative remarks.

Some diners encountered incredibly slow service, long waiting times, and instances of poor service, sometimes due to being understaffed. This leads to an overall score of 5.5 (average) and a customer satisfaction of 47.9% (mixed) across 163 total opinions.

Ambience (7.5 out of 10)

mentioned by 51% of the guests

The ambiance here truly shines, earning a 7.5 score and leaving 82% of customers satisfied! With 73 positive observations out of 89 total, guests frequently praise the serene atmosphere, chic restaurant vibe, and dim lighting, often noting its casual elegance. Many found it a beautiful, spacious, and cozy spot, perfect for a quiet dinner or a date, creating a truly pleasant experience.

However, not all experiences were perfect, with 13 negative remarks. Some found it not very kid-friendly, and a few mentioned issues with table proximity, leading to a deteriorated atmosphere. There were also comments about a cold decor in some areas, and a concerning mention of a roach crawling around, which certainly detracts from the overall environment.

Value (2.7 out of 10)

mentioned by 37% of the guests

While the overall sentiment around value isnt stellar, a few diners found some bright spots. Some appreciated the "price" and "competitive price, " noting that the food was "reasonably priced" and "affordable" for the quality. With 9 positive remarks, a small group felt they got good value, especially for a pre-theater meal or a date night.

However, the overwhelming majority of feedback paints a different picture. With a 2.7 score for value and a mere 11.5% customer satisfaction, its clear that many felt the experience was poor. Out of 78 total comments, a staggering 65 pointed to issues like overpriced dishes, expensive prices, and frustrating hidden fees or automatic gratuity.

Many felt the final bill was a shock.

My experience at this rustic Italian restaurant near Union Square in San Francisco, attached to the Marker Hotel on Geary St. , was a mix of good food and somewhat inconsistent service. We visited early on a Monday evening, and it wasn't busy, which made me wonder why we still had to wait for our table despite having a reservation. For our appetizer, we ordered a beet salad, and for our entrees, we enjoyed the Spaghetti con Vongole and the Gnocchi pesto. Both dishes were very good, with adequate, though not huge, serving sizes. The service, however, was hit and miss; we experienced several minutes of waiting for our table to be cleared, and we also had to ask for the check. Overall, the food was a highlight, but the service could be improved.
